One common area of confusion is the role of enzymes like DNA polymerase and helicase. The answer key can clearly show you how these enzymes function during replication. Understanding their roles is key to grasping the whole process and how it all comes together.
Pay close attention to the direction of replication. DNA polymerase can only add nucleotides to the 3′ end of a strand. If you are struggling with this, the dna replication practice worksheet answer key can give a clear explanation on lagging and leading strands synthesis.
Don’t be afraid to look up terms you don’t understand. Use online resources or your textbook to refresh your memory on concepts like Okazaki fragments or the role of ligase. Combine the worksheet with different learning approaches to build the best understanding of DNA replication.
